MMV291 disrupts actin-dependent apicoplast segregation and induces a partial delayed death phenotype.
Published 2023“…<p><b>(A) i</b> Representative panels from live cell imaging of apicoplast targeted acyl carrier protein (ACP) tagged with GFP revealed that treatment of trophozoites for 24 hours with both 5 μM and 10 μM MMV291 (10 and 20 × EC<sub>50</sub>) disrupted apicoplast segregation, resulting in an increase in abnormal apicoplast clumping at schizonts. …”

Supplementary Material for: Visit-to-Visit Variability in Total Cholesterol Correlates with the Progression of Renal Function Decline in a Chinese Community-Based Hypertensive Popu...
Published 2019“…TC variability was measured using standard deviation (SD), average successive variability (ASV), coefficient of variation (CV), and variability independent of the mean (VIM). The endpoint of this study was progression of renal function decline defined as a decrease in estimated glomerular filtration rate (eGFR) ≥30% and to a level <60 mL/min/1.73 m<sup>2</sup> during follow-up if the baseline eGFR was ≥60 mL/min/1.73 m<sup>2</sup>, or a decrease in eGFR ≥50% during follow up if the baseline eGFR was <60 mL/min/1.73 m<sup>2</sup>. …”
